Mechanical Scrubbing vs. Chemical Shielding: How Dental Chews and Liquid Solutions Attempt to Fight Plaque

Evaluating at-home dental remedies requires a basic understanding of the biological difference between soft plaque and hardened tartar. Plaque is a sticky, nearly invisible film composed of salivary proteins, food debris, and live bacteria that blankets the teeth within hours after a meal. At this early stage, the biofilm is soft and structurally vulnerable, which is where retail products focus their defensive mechanisms. Dental chews and liquid additives attempt to interrupt this bacterial accumulation using completely different pathways, relying either on mechanical friction or chemical alterations to protect the enamel.

The design of a high-quality dental chew relies on the physical abrasion model of cleaning. These treats are manufactured with specific, highly textured ridges, grooved patterns, or dense, rubbery matrixes that resist immediate breakdown. As a dog bites down, the tooth sinks into the treat, allowing the firm edges to physically scrape against the enamel, slicing through soft plaque deposits before they can accumulate. This mechanical scrubbing mimics the action of a traditional toothbrush, targeting the broad chewing surfaces of the larger premolars and molars where food residue naturally gathers. Liquid water additives approach the problem from a chemical shielding perspective. Rather than scraping the teeth, these solutions are mixed directly into the dog’s daily drinking supply. They typically contain active components like zinc gluconate, chlorhexidine, or specialized enzymes designed to alter the chemistry of the animal’s saliva. The primary objective is to create an inhospitable environment for oral pathogens, breaking down bacterial cell walls and preventing soft plaque films from bonding to the smooth outer enamel. While both methods possess clear theoretical benefits, their real-world applications are limited by several operational hurdles:
  • Individual chewing styles often compromise dental treats, as aggressive chewers frequently bypass the mechanical design by fracturing and swallowing the chew in large chunks within seconds.
  • Anatomical limitations mean standard dental chews rarely make contact with the tiny incisors at the front of the mouth or the deep upper molars where heavy buildup hides.
  • Environmental dilution impacts water additives significantly, as multi-pet households, sunlight exposure, and rapid evaporation cause liquid solutions to lose their clinical concentration inside a shared bowl.
  • Selectivity gaps exist because chemical solutions might successfully neutralize odor-causing volatile sulfur compounds without actually disrupting the physical biofilm attached to the gumline.

The Mineralized Wall: Why Hardened Calculus Defies Retail Pet Remedies

The fundamental limitation of over-the-counter dental products lies in a rapid chemical transformation that occurs naturally inside a dog’s mouth. If soft bacterial plaque is not completely removed within forty-eight hours, it undergoes a process known as mineralization. Canine saliva naturally contains high concentrations of essential minerals, specifically calcium and phosphorus, designed to protect dental structures. However, when these minerals mix continuously with an unmanaged bacterial matrix, they bind together, transforming a soft, sticky film into a rock-hard, cement-like substance called dental calculus, or tartar.

Once calculus forms a mineralized bond with the tooth enamel, the playground rules of oral hygiene change entirely. Tartar acts as a highly durable, calcified wall that is completely impervious to the mechanical friction of a dental chew or the chemical actions of a water additive. At this stage, continuing to rely on store-bought treats to remove the buildup is like trying to clear a concrete wall with a soft kitchen sponge. The hard outer shell of the tartar protects the underlying active bacterial colonies, allowing them to expand and thrive against the tooth structure without disruption. This structural reality means that while additives and treats can be useful tools for slowing down the initial formation of soft plaque, they are entirely ineffective at reversing existing tartar buildup. When a pet owner notices thick, brown, or yellow mineralized rings accumulating along their dog’s upper gumline, the window for at-home prevention has closed. No amount of chewing or liquid solution can dissolve that calcified matrix. Attempting to scratch or chip the tartar away at home using retail scaling tools is also highly dangerous, as it creates microscopic scratches on the enamel that act as perfect nesting sites for future, more aggressive bacterial colonies.

The Hidden Perils of Periodontal Disease: What At-Home Treats Fail to Reach Beneath the Gumline

The true measure of a dog’s oral health cannot be determined by the visible white surfaces of their teeth. The most destructive aspect of canine oral illness occurs entirely out of sight, deep beneath the delicate tissue of the gumline. As hardened tartar continues to accumulate along the neck of the tooth, it expands downward, forcing its way under the free gingival margin. This physical intrusion breaks the vital biological seal between the tooth root and the surrounding gums, creating an ideal, oxygen-deprived environment where destructive anaerobic bacteria can multiply unchecked.

This subsurface invasion triggers a progressive condition known as periodontal disease. As the anaerobic bacteria expand inside these hidden pockets, the dog’s immune system sends white blood cells to combat the infection, leading to chronic localized inflammation. This continuous inflammatory response degrades the delicate periodontal ligaments and the alveolar bone structures that physically anchor the tooth roots into the jawbone. Because at-home chews and water additives only interact with the visible crown of the tooth, they cannot reach these deep periodontal pockets, leaving the underlying destruction to progress silently. Ignoring this subsurface degradation results in serious, multi-systemic consequences for an animal’s body:
  • Chronic localized pain alters a dog’s daily behavior, frequently manifesting as subtle grumpiness, hesitating before eating hard food, or pulling away from head scratches, signs that owners often mistake for simple aging.
  • Advanced root decay leads to painful tooth root abscesses, which can erode straight through the maxillary bone, causing sudden facial swelling beneath the eye or chronic, unilateral nasal discharge.
  • The continuous breakdown of oral tissue allows pathogenic bacteria to enter the bloodstream directly, where they travel to vital filter organs, placing severe chronic stress on the heart valves, kidneys, and liver.

A proper veterinary dental procedure requires a structured, multi-step protocol that cannot be duplicated by at-home remedies or awake grooming scrapes. The clinical staff ensures every patient moves through a safe, thorough process:
  • Comprehensive Wellness Exams: Before any procedure, doctors perform full physical checks and baseline blood screenings to evaluate kidney and liver function, ensuring the pet can safely process medications.
  • Safe, Regulated Anesthesia: Reaching beneath the gumline and taking digital x-rays requires absolute immobility, which is achieved through customized anesthesia protocols and continuous electronic vitals monitoring of heart rate, blood pressure, and oxygen levels.
  • Advanced Ultrasonic Scaling: Technicians use specialized vibrating tools to safely shatter hardened calculus from the visible crown and, crucially, from deep within the periodontal pockets beneath the gumline.
  • Detailed Enamel Polishing: Following scaling, the teeth are polished using a specialized prophy paste to smooth out microscopic surface scratches, preventing new bacterial biofilms from easily adhering to the smooth enamel.
  • Surgical Care and Precise Extractions: If high-resolution imaging reveals advanced bone loss or a fractured root, the veterinary team performs precise surgical extractions to remove non-viable, painful teeth and prevent the infection from spreading through the jawbone.
Through this detailed approach, the medical team addresses the root causes of oral discomfort, restoring a clean, healthy mouth and preventing secondary systemic issues.

Q2: Why do structural oral cleanings at the Main Street location require sedation rather than an awake grooming scrape?
Cleaning a dog’s teeth while they are awake is purely cosmetic and can be highly dangerous. An awake animal will not permit a practitioner to scrape beneath the gumline where the most destructive bacteria live, and the sudden movements risk fracturing the teeth or cutting the delicate oral tissues with sharp instruments.
